Could Slight Pain And Discomfort Be Symptoms Of Hernia?
I had two hernia repairs within the last 18 months - one direct and then an indirect one. Last one done four months ago. I have slight pain/discomfort above the direct one. Not sure I feel another hernia or if I just have pain (1 on scale of 1 to 10) as a result of light workout I did a week ago.
Hi, It seems that due to adhesion formation at the site of hernia repair might give this problem. If there is massive abdominal muscle weakness or laxity does give recurrence. If bulging and discomfort is there consult surgeon and get examined. Avoid lifting heavy weight, constipation and cough reflex. Ok and take care.
